
CivilGEO Reaffirms Market Leadership in G2’s Summer 2025 Report

MADISON, WI, July 15, 2025 – CivilGEO, a leading provider of civil engineering software, has once again made a significant impact in G2’s Summer 2025 Grid® Reports. The company earned a total of 37 badges across its product suite, with its newest software, GeoSTORM, earning the prestigious “High Performer” badge in its debut quarter.
G2, the world’s largest software marketplace, evaluates products based on verified user reviews and performance metrics. Its quarterly Grid® Reports help engineers, industry leaders, and professionals make smarter software decisions by showcasing top-performing solutions.

Continued Recognition for CivilGEO Flagship Products
Alongside GeoSTORM’s debut success, CivilGEO’s trusted solutions, GeoHECRAS and GeoHECHMS, maintained strong positions in their respective categories:
GeoHECRAS: Named a “Leader” in five major categories for its unmatched river modeling, bridge analysis, and floodplain mapping capabilities.
GeoHECHMS: Continued as a “High Performer” and received the “Easiest to Do Business With” recognition for its advanced stormwater and hydrologic modeling tools.

About CivilGEO, Inc.:
CivilGEO, Inc. is a privately held company headquartered in Madison, WI, with satellite offices in Canada, South America, Europe, and the Asia Pacific Region. It is a leading provider of civil engineering software, which has been designed to meet the highest performance standards held by civil engineering consulting firms and government agencies worldwide.
